Marguerite (Marge) E. McMillin, 92, of Westbrook, Maine, died Saturday, Dec. 29, 2012 at Springbrook Nursing Center in Westbrook.  She bravely and with grace battled Multiple Myeloma and more recently Colon cancer and Liver cancer. She was born July 18, 1920 in Lakeville, New Brunswick, Canadato John and Harriet Fowler Morris and moved to Portland, Maine with her family when she was three.  Marge proudly became a naturalized citizen of the US in 1945. She met the love of her life, Glenn E. McMillin, when they were teenagers at a church retreat.  They married July 15, 1945 after Glenn came back from WWII serving in the US Army.  She worked three nights a week in the Air Force Auxiliary while at the same time working a full time job. Marge received the Braun Medal when graduating from Portland High School as one of the top 5 girls in her class and then went on to business college.  She said she "never had a day she didn't enjoy going to work".  Marge worked as an accountant for Cook, Everett & Pennell and later working in the office at Weyerhauser in Westbrook. She was a kind, loving Mother, Grandmother, Great Grandmother and Friend who always had a positive attitude, even through her sickness.   She loved people and was willing to help however she could.  She enjoyed visiting family in Arizona, entertaining people at their camp in North Windham and meeting with people of her church. Marge was an active member in the Methodist church from a young age and most recently enjoyed being a member of the Cressey Road United Methodist Church in Gorham.
